Parking Services would like to remind everyone that bicycles/micro-mobility scooters must be registered, and a permit is...
04/28/2026

Parking Services would like to remind everyone that bicycles/micro-mobility scooters must be registered, and a permit is required. To register, please go to our online self-service parking portal at parking.cmich.edu. Please take your bicycles/micro-mobility scooters home if you will not be using them on campus during the summer.

Bicycles/micro-mobility scooters that are illegally parked, unregistered, or inoperable will be impounded on May 14th by the CMU Police Department. After 30 days of impound, bicycles/micro-mobility scooters will be forwarded to the CMU Surplus Store and sold. CMU ordinances 12.02, 12.06, and 12.21.
